Medical Assistant - OB/GYN
 - Charles B. Wang Community Health Center (Queens, NY)
 - 
             
+ Direct patient care and support
+ Perform nursing tasks under the direction of the registered nurse or authorized health care providers
+ Interview patients and records medical history, take vital signs, and prepare patients for medical visits
+ Conduct health/risk screening using standardized tools
+ Collect laboratory specimens as ordered
+ Assist providers in procedures using sterile or aseptic techniques
+ Promote patient self-management by providing patient education, appointment reminders and support in collaboration with the care team
+ Facilitate communication for patients and health care providers by providing translation or interpretation as needed
+ Complete accurate EMR documentation of patient information and services provided
+ Effective teamwork, communication and collaboration as part of practice-wide care team
+ Demonstrate curiosity and understanding of patient registration, administrative workflows and prior authorization processes
+ Collaborate with the care team to conduct pre-visit planning and post-visit follow-up
+ Participate in Quality Improvement (QI) projects and other related activities
+ Maintain a cooperative relationship among health care teams by communicating information; responding to requests; and participating in team problem-solving
+ Adapt to changes in practice operations, workflows and patient needs as they emerge
+ Perform other duties as assigned
